1. Replace Old Hardware

Believe it or not, one of the quickest and easiest ways to add a splash of creative curb appeal is by simply replacing old hardware.

For example, consider updating the entry door lockset and hinges, replace the gate latch, and add some modern flair to the overhead light on the porch.

Keep in mind that the hardware around your house gets dingy or the years, looking rusted or weathered, and may not possess the same charm that it used to.

Are you planning to repaint this exterior of your house soon? If so, that would be a perfect time to upgrade your hardware in order to complete the aesthetic transformation.

2. Update Your Landscaping

Nothing adds new life to a home quite like gorgeous landscaping. There are endless ways to add bursts of color and lush green foliage. This includes building a flower box around the mailbox, adding a hedge around the perimeter of the house, or planting trees.

The key to effective landscaping is to use it to enhance the other elements of your house. This can be a fun DIY project or you could consider hiring professional landscapers to make sure the job gets done right.

3. Focus On Creating Perfect Symmetry

One of the best ways to maximize curb appeal is to create symmetry. After all, symmetry is pleasing to the eye and is simple to arrange.

The key is to focus on the small touches, such as flanking your front door with sidelights or landscaping the sides of your front steps with beautiful rose bushes.

You don’t have to be a professional designer to create symmetry, thus anyone can create a gorgeous exterior, even on a limited budget.

4. Install Outdoor Lighting

Installing or updating your outdoor lighting is another great tip for how to add curb appeal to a home with minimal investment. Just remember that small details make a big difference, such as adding simple lanterns along a garden path.

5. Dress Up Your Driveway

You can also dress up your drive. Perhaps add flower boxes for a touch of color or guide lights so that you’ll never have to arrive home in the dark.
